在浏览网站时,我们经常会遇到需要跳转到下一页的情况,尤其是在查看长篇文章、商品列表或搜索结果时。网站如何实现跳转下一页的功能,以及相关的文件格式是如何设计的呢?本文将为您详细解答。

1. 网站跳转下一页的基本原理

网站跳转下一页的功能通常是通过分页技术实现的。分页技术将大量内容分成多个页面,用户可以通过点击“下一页”按钮或页码来浏览不同的页面。实现这一功能的核心技术包括:

  • 前端技术:HTML、CSS和JavaScript用于创建分页按钮和页面布局。JavaScript可以处理用户的点击事件,动态加载下一页的内容。
  • 后端技术:服务器端语言(如PHP、Python、Java等)负责处理分页请求,从数据库中提取相应的数据并返回给前端。

2. 文件格式在分页中的作用

在网站分页过程中,文件格式的选择对用户体验和性能有着重要影响。常见的文件格式包括:

  • HTML:用于构建网页的基本结构。分页按钮和内容通常以HTML元素的形式呈现。
  • CSS:用于美化分页按钮和页面布局,提升用户体验。
  • JavaScript:用于实现动态加载和交互功能。例如,通过AJAX技术,可以在不刷新整个页面的情况下加载下一页的内容。
  • JSON:在前后端数据交互中,JSON格式常用于传输分页数据。服务器将分页数据以JSON格式返回给前端,前端再将其渲染到页面上。

3. 实现分页的常见方法

  • 传统分页:每次点击“下一页”按钮时,整个页面都会刷新,服务器返回新的HTML页面。这种方法简单易实现,但用户体验较差。
  • AJAX分页:通过AJAX技术,前端向服务器发送请求,服务器返回JSON格式的数据,前端动态更新页面内容。这种方法提升了用户体验,减少了页面刷新次数。
  • 无限滚动:当用户滚动到页面底部时,自动加载下一页的内容。这种方法适用于内容流式展示的场景,如社交媒体和新闻网站。

4. 优化分页体验的技巧

  • 预加载:在用户浏览当前页面时,提前加载下一页的内容,减少等待时间。
  • 缓存:将已加载的页面内容缓存到本地,用户返回时无需重新加载。
  • 分页指示器:显示当前页码和总页数,帮助用户了解浏览进度。
  • 响应式设计:确保分页功能在不同设备上都能良好展示,提升移动端用户体验。

5. 总结

网站跳转下一页的功能是提升用户体验的重要手段,合理选择文件格式和实现方法可以显著提升网站的性能和用户满意度。通过前端和后端的协同工作,结合AJAX、JSON等技术,可以实现高效、流畅的分页体验。希望本文能为您在设计和优化网站分页功能时提供有价值的参考。